Use of hyperbaric oxygen therapy in Hong Kong
RA Ramaswami, WK Lo Recompression Treatment Centre, Stonecutters Island, Hong Kong
The Recompression Treatment Centre on Stonecutters Island has been operating in Hong Kong for more than 5 years and has been used to treat a variety of diving-related and other conditions by means of hyperbaric oxygen therapy. Up to the end of December 1997, 295 treatment sessions had been conducted for 39 patients. This article reviews the usefulness of and indications for hyperbaric oxygen therapy.
Hong Kong Med J 2000;6:108-12
Key words: Barotrauma; Carbon monoxide poisoning; Decompression sickness; Embolism, air; Hyperbaric oxygenation; Radiation injuries
